Cameroonian Visa on Arrival (diplomatic and service passports)
A visa issued at the border for holders of diplomatic or service passports travelling to Cameroon on official government business.

Who it is for
- Government officials and diplomats on official missions
- Holders of diplomatic or service passports from eligible countries
Requirements
- Valid diplomatic or service passport
- Official mission order
- Confirmed return ticket
- Yellow fever vaccination certificate
How to apply
Diplomatic and service passport holders do not apply through the evisacam.cm online portal. The application is submitted through official channels to the Cameroonian embassy or high commission (in person, or by mail/email as the mission directs).
Send the mission a Note Verbale together with the passport and the required documents. The Note Verbale must be issued by the Ministry of Foreign Affairs, a diplomatic mission, or an international organisation.
If your file is validated but there is no Cameroonian mission in your country, you complete the process on arrival: your biometrics are enrolled at the entry point and the visa sticker is affixed to your passport there.
Documents you may need
- A diplomatic or service (official) passport valid for at least six months
- A completed visa application form
- A Note Verbale from the Ministry of Foreign Affairs, a diplomatic mission, or an international organisation, accompanying the passport
- Supporting documents for the official mission or duty (for example an official mission order or invitation), as requested by the Cameroonian mission
